Boston area jails are crumbling and unsafe

Boston area jails are old, extremely overcrowed and often unsafe. State jails intended to hold a total of 7,802 are now holding 11,126 inmates. Some individual facilities are operating at as much as 350 percent of their capacity. The Middlesex County Jail still houses inmates with nowhere else to go despite the fact that a judge ordered it closed in 2005 because of the risk of asbestos exposure to inmates and employees at the jail. The Bristol County Ash Street Jail does not have automatic door locks, which means that in a fire, each door must be manually opened by a correctional officer. At least $30 million is needed to fix immediate and serious hazards in these older jails, and hundreds of millions of dollars will be needed over the long term. Funding is running low. The governor has pledged $143 million to the corrections department from a proposed bond package, but there are many demands on the funds.
